yarakigit / chouseisan_script

調整さんの候補日程を自動生成

Home Page:https://qiita.com/yarakigit/items/7f23052bfb6014516185

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

chouseisan_script

調整さんの候補日程を自動生成

使い方

  1. 本リポジトリをfork
  2. Actions >> I understand my workflows, go ahead and enable themをクリック screen_shot_1
  3. setting.csvを変更してpush
  4. Github Actionsを用いて自動実行
  5. output.txt調整さんにコピペ

setting.csvについて

  • setting.csvの例
    • 2022年07月11日~07月19日の期間, 13時から19時の間に2時間おきに候補日程が生成されます。
      • 曜日の行を0にすると、その曜日は候補日から除外されます。
        • この例だと土曜、日曜を除く平日のみ候補日程が生成されます。
      • exlusion date : 7月18日は候補日から除外
      • exlusion time : 15時は除外
year,2022
start date,07,11
finish date,07,19
Monday,1
Tuesday,1
Wednesday,1
Thursday,1
Friday,1
Saturday,0
Sunday,0
time start,13
time finish,19
time span,2
exclusion date,7,18
exclusion time,15

生成されたoutput.txt

7/11(月) 13:00~
7/11(月) 17:00~
7/11(月) 19:00~
7/12(火) 13:00~
7/12(火) 17:00~
7/12(火) 19:00~
7/13(水) 13:00~
7/13(水) 17:00~
7/13(水) 19:00~
7/14(木) 13:00~
7/14(木) 17:00~
7/14(木) 19:00~
7/15(金) 13:00~
7/15(金) 17:00~
7/15(金) 19:00~
7/19(火) 13:00~
7/19(火) 17:00~
7/19(火) 19:00~

About

調整さんの候補日程を自動生成

https://qiita.com/yarakigit/items/7f23052bfb6014516185


Languages

Language:Python 100.0%